May Sinclair
- Favourite Briton.

Born in Rock Ferry, Cheshire
Born on 24th of August 1863
Died on 14th of November 1946

Born 1863. Died 1946 - English novelist.

Educated at Cheltenham Ladies’ College. Interested in psychoanalysis. Advocate of women’s suffrage. Her 24 novels include The Creators (1910), The Three Sisters (1914) and The Life and Death of Harriett Frean (1922).
